Challenges in Implementing Time Clocks

Overcoming the Obstacles of Time Clock Systems

Implementing time clock systems in a modern workplace can bring about a variety of challenges. These hurdles, if not properly addressed, could impede the accuracy of employee time tracking and hinder the overall efficiency of a business. Understanding these challenges is the first step toward crafting effective time tracking solutions for both large and small businesses.

Complexity in Integration

One of the primary challenges of implementing time clocks is the complexity involved in integrating these systems with existing payroll and attendance structures. Businesses need to ensure seamless synchronization between time clocks and payroll systems to accurately calculate hours worked by employees. This often involves investing in compatible time clock software or employing online time systems that facilitate easy data transfer and minimize errors in time card calculations.

Employee Resistance and Adaptation

Another significant challenge is the potential resistance from employees who might be wary of additional monitoring. Initial resistance can be due to concerns about privacy or simply the disruption of established work routines. To counteract this, businesses should focus on transparent communication about the benefits of accurate time tracking, explaining how it contributes to fair payroll practices and ultimately enhances their overall work experience. Offering training on using new time clocks or employee time apps could also ease the transition.

Technical Troubles and Reliability

Technical issues present another hurdle in time clock implementation. Whether it's a malfunctioning clock that doesn't accurately record work hours or software that struggles with calculating time efficiently, technical reliability can significantly impact time tracking efficiency. This emphasizes the need for robust time clock systems with reliable support that ensures timely troubleshooting and minimal downtime.

Emerging Trends in Time Tracking Technology

As businesses continue to evolve, so do the tools they use to enhance employee experience. Time tracking systems are no exception. With the rise of digital transformation, companies are increasingly adopting innovative solutions that make tracking work hours more efficient and accurate.

Integration with Other Business Systems

One of the most significant trends is the integration of time clocks with other business systems. By connecting time tracking software with payroll and attendance systems, companies can streamline processes and reduce errors in calculating hours worked. This integration ensures that employees are paid accurately and on time, enhancing their overall experience.

Mobile and Cloud-Based Solutions

Mobile apps and cloud-based platforms are becoming more popular for tracking employee time. These solutions offer flexibility, allowing employees to clock in and out from anywhere, whether they're working remotely or on-site. This ease of access is particularly beneficial for small businesses that need a cost-effective and scalable solution.

AI and Machine Learning in Time Tracking

Artificial intelligence and machine learning are also making their way into time tracking systems. These technologies can help predict patterns in employee attendance and identify potential issues before they become problems. For example, AI can analyze time card data to detect anomalies, ensuring that time tracking is both accurate and fair.

Focus on Employee Privacy

As technology advances, there is a growing emphasis on protecting employee privacy. Companies are implementing systems that ensure data security while maintaining transparency with employees about how their time data is used. This balance is crucial for building trust and enhancing the employee experience.
